About this home

We found 3 Cons,5 Pros.

Wonderful opportunity to own this rare 2-bedroom, 1 bathroom unit in the historic Figueroa Arms complex perfect for first time home buyer, USC Student, or staff. This 4-story building features a gym, beautiful central courtyard, onsite laundry, dog run, and nightly on duty security. This is a first-floor corner unit with only one shared wall and high ceiling. The kitchen has updated cabinets and with some TLC this unit you can be pristine. HOA includes security, water, trash and exterior building maintenance. You may even qualify for the USC Neighborhood Homeownership Program. Discover urban living in the heart of Los Angeles close to USC, LA Coliseum, BMO Stadium and just a short distance to restaurants and supermarkets. This is a prime location near downtown LA, Crypto Arena, Nokia Theatre, Exposition Park, Expo Line at USC, 110 Freeway, metro, Disney Concert Hall and so many other attractions and amenities LA has to offer. It’s the perfect space to be when the 2028 Olympics come to town. Tax rolls show different bedroom count. Property sold in as-is condition and seller will make no repairs.

Condition Rating
Fair

Built in 1927, this property is aged. While the kitchen has 'updated cabinets,' the appliances are older white models, countertops are dated laminate, and the flooring is utilitarian tile. The bathroom is very dated with an old vanity, sink, faucet, and light fixture. Hardwood floors show significant wear and require refinishing. Overall, the unit is functional but requires substantial cosmetic updates and repairs to meet current standards, aligning with the 'fair' condition criteria of being aged but maintained, with major components functional but outdated, and requiring minor updates or repairs.
